Kiril Sotirovski is a scholar working on Plant Science, Endocrinology and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Kiril Sotirovski has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 302 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Plant Science, 12 papers in Endocrinology and 5 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Kiril Sotirovski’s work include Plant and Fungal Interactions Research (12 papers), Plant Virus Research Studies (10 papers) and Plant Pathogens and Fungal Diseases (5 papers). Kiril Sotirovski is often cited by papers focused on Plant and Fungal Interactions Research (12 papers), Plant Virus Research Studies (10 papers) and Plant Pathogens and Fungal Diseases (5 papers). Kiril Sotirovski collaborates with scholars based in North Macedonia, United States and Switzerland. Kiril Sotirovski's co-authors include Michael G. Milgroom, Irena Papazova–Anakieva, Marin T. Brewer, P. Cortesi, Daniel Rigling, Niklaus J. Grünwald, U. Heiniger, Joanne E. Davis, Mirna Ćurković‐Perica and Simone Prospero and has published in prestigious journals such as Molecular Ecology, Environmental Microbiology and Phytopathology.
